実現したいこと
listFiles()関数を使用して全てのファイル名を取得したい
前提
Android studioでjava開発をしています。
やりたい事はスマホのダウンロードフォルダのファイル一覧を取得してリストビューにファイル一覧を表示させたいと言う事です。
発生している問題・エラーメッセージ
ダウンロードフォルダには「CSV」「txt」「jpg」ファイルの三種類のファイルがあるのですが、何故か「jpg」のファイルしかlistFiles()関数で取得が出来ません。
該当のソースコード
java
1File file = new File("/storage/emulated/0/Download"); 2File[] fileList = file.listFiles();
試したこと
1,読み込めないファイル(CSVとTXT)の削除と再ダウンロード
2,"/storage/emulated/0/Download"へのアクセス権の確認
→もしアクセス権の問題があるならばjpgファイルも読めないはずなので問題ない認識
補足情報(FW/ツールのバージョンなど)
【開発環境】
Android Studio Electric Eel | 2022.1.1 Patch 1
Build #AI-221.6008.13.2211.9514443, built on January 21, 2023
Runtime version: 11.0.15+0-b2043.56-9505619 amd64
VM: OpenJDK 64-Bit Server VM by JetBrains s.r.o.
Windows 10 10.0
GC: G1 Young Generation, G1 Old Generation
Memory: 1280M
Cores: 8
Registry:
external.system.auto.import.disabled=true
ide.text.editor.with.preview.show.floating.toolbar=false
※本質問に関して情報不足している場合はお手数ですがご指摘頂けると幸いです。よろしくお願い致します。

回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2023/02/11 19:13